The recent approval of the new UV filter, bemotrizinol (BEMT), will have an immediate positive impact on the sunscreen industry, and its overall impact will be huge. It marks a turning point in the development of superior global sunscreen products in the US.

The path for approval has been long and arduous and has spanned nearly three decades starting with Ciba’s introduction of bemotrizinol (Tinosorb S) at the turn of the century, then to BASF which acquired Tinosorb S from Ciba, and finally to DSM with Parsol Shield.  

The regulatory path was daunting to say the least.  We formed the PASS Coalition in early 2000 primarily to work with US Congress and the FDA to introduce sorely needed new UV filters that are broad spectrum, more photostable that effectively reduce the damage to the skin from the longer wavelength UVA radiation.  We worked with Congress to introduce The Sunscreen Innovation Act (SIA) that was signed by President Obama into law in November 2014. That legislation went by the wayside until the CARES Act was introduced in 2020 during the pandemic, which was also largely ignored by the FDA in approving new UV filters.  Finally, the SAFE Sunscreen Standards Act was approved in 2025. 

Approval of BEMT took years of communication with the FDA. Tada Images/Shutterstock.com

After several meetings with the FDA, bemotrizinol was finally approved at 6% on June 9, 2026 as a Category I GRASE sunscreen UV filter. After the 60-day comment period, the new UV filter can be used in suncare products in the US commencing August 10, 2026.

DSM-Firmenich receives all the credit for sponsoring the OMOR (Over-the-counter Monograph Order Request) Tier I application. The company endured several years of ongoing communication with the FDA and complied with all their demands for toxicological, pharmacological, and safety tests to gain this landmark approval.  Most importantly, DSM-Firmenich submitted data in compliance of the MUsT test (Maximal Use Trial Test) at a considerable cost, time and effort.  The test used 75% of body surface area, administered four applications per day on multiple consecutive days on 162 patients.  The skin absorption level of BEMT was well below the 0.5ng maximum absorption level set by the FDA. We finally have a UV filter properly designed according to the 500 Dalton Rule which effectively prevents molecules from penetrating the skin.  It should be noted that all the organic absorbing UV filters approved in the US, except for ZnO and TiO2, are smaller molecules that are well below the 500 Daltons and are thus subject to skin penetration.

Bemotrizinol is a photostable, safe broad-spectrum molecule.  Its molecular weight (MW) is 628 g/mol with a triazine backbone structure with two octyl groups attached that are designed to decrease the water solubility of the molecule significantly. It is a yellowish solid and the use of specific emollients to solubilize this molecule is required. BEMT’s ultraviolet absorption is outstanding with two UV maxima at 310 nm and 343 nm.  The 310 nm absorption covers the UVB radiation very effectively with an Extinction Coefficient of 46,800, and the 343 nm absorption covers the UVA radiation with a huge Extinction Coefficient of 51,900. Note that Octisalate, for example, has a λmax at 308 nm with an Extinction Coefficient of 4,130 and a MW of 250!

BEMT is now approved everywhere in the world. It is compatible with every UV filter in commerce today.  This will allow hybrid formulations with ZnO and TiO2 for the first time in the US. 

Combinations of ZnO and TiO2 with the only effective avobenzone have not been allowed in the US. 

With this new development, manufacturers will accomplish a myriad of formulations and reduce actives significantly, that hitherto have not been permitted or practical in the US:

  1. US sunscreen products will now be approved globally.
  2. Hybrid formulations with ZnO/TiO2  and organic UV absorbing molecules are now permitted.
  3. Bemotrizinol is a photostable molecule unlike the photo unstable Avobenzone. This also means that you will not need to add quenchers such as octocrylene, oxybenzone or the myriad so-called T-T quenchers to photostabilize avobenzone. Those T-T quenchers include Corapan TQ (DEHN), Oxynex ST (DESM), Polycrylene (Polyester-8), Solastay SI, Synoxyl HSS and others.
  4. Since bemotrizinol is an efficient broad-spectrum (UVA and UVB)
    absorber, the need for non-FDA approved boosters such as salicylates, octocrylene and cinnamate derivatives are no longer required. The use of natural boosters with other attributes, however, would be highly recommended.
  5. Bemotrizinol effectively covers the so-called 320 nm gap since all currently approved UV filters including avobenzone, homosalate, octisalate, octinoxate and even ZnO and TiO2 have minimal absorption in the 320 nm region.

This new approved molecule has been used safely and effectively for more than 20 years around the world. It is not covered by patents, but Congress allows the sponsor (DSM in this case) an 18-month exclusive term.
